背景情况:
- 维泰克斯L. (Verbenaceae) 属具有丰富的民族药理学历史.
- 维泰克斯尼贡多在传统中医 (TCM) 中专门用于缺血性中风.
- 这使其研究潜力与其他民族植物学用途有所区别.
研究的目的:
- 系统地审查Vitex L.成分及其对缺血性中风的疗效.
- 为了阐明作用的潜在机制.
- 引导基于Vitex的中风疗法的临床前和临床开发.
主要方法:
- 在主要的英语和中文数据库 (Web of Science,Pubmed,CNKI,Wanfang Data) 进行系统的文献搜索.
- 识别和分析Vitex L. 的天然成分.
- 对抗缺血性中风效应和机制的体外和体内研究的综述.
主要成果:
- 确定了200多种成分,包括关键的黄类,类和类.
- 在MCAO大鼠模型中,Vitexin通过阻断NMDA受体介导的Ca2+过载,显著减少了心脏病发作体积 (30-40%).
- 机制包括向神经元,质细胞和血管细胞,调节Nrf2,NF-κB,PI3K/Akt,铁,热和表观遗传等途径.
结论:
- 维泰克斯L.由于独特的成分和多途径调节,具有显著的抗缺血性中风潜力.
- 协同效应和优化提取/合成对于克服低含量挑战至关重要.
- 未来的研究应该优先考虑多中心验证,协同机制研究和临床试验.
